#300baa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#300baa is composed of 18.8% red, 4.3% green and 66.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 71.8% cyan, 93.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 33.3% black. It has a hue angle of 254 degrees, a saturation of 87.8% and a lightness of 35.5%. #300baa color hex could be obtained by blending #6016ff with #000055. Closest websafe color is: #330099.

#300baa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#300baa has RGB values of R:48, G:11, B:170 and CMYK values of C:0.72, M:0.94, Y:0, K:0.33. Its decimal value is 3148714.

Shades and Tints of #300baa
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010004 is the darkest color, while #f4f1f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#300baa
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#59585d is the less saturated color, while #2c04b1 is the most saturated one.
